The Timeless Elegance of Timber Sash Windows: A Comprehensive Guide

For centuries, lumber sash windows have been a specifying feature of British architecture. From the grand proportions of Georgian townhouses to the elaborate information of Victorian Sash Windows rental properties and the downplayed appeal of Edwardian terraces, these windows represent an ideal marriage of form and function. While contemporary materials like uPVC and aluminum have gone into the marketplace, the conventional timber sash stays the gold standard for homeowners seeking authenticity, durability, and thermal performance.

This guide checks out the history, benefits, technical specs, and maintenance requirements of lumber sash windows, supplying a comprehensive summary for those considering a repair or replacement job.


The History and Evolution of the Sash Window

The origin of the Sliding Sash Window Company sash window go back to the late 17th century. Unlike the casement windows that preceded them, sash windows operate on a vertical Sliding Sash Window Installers system. Early styles used an easy system of pegs, however this eventually evolved into the sophisticated counterbalanced system including weights, pulley-blocks, and cords housed within a "box" frame.

Throughout the 18th and 19th centuries, the design of these windows moved to reflect changing architectural tastes and enhancements in glass production.

  • Georgian (1714-- 1837): Typically featured a "six-over-six" pane setup with thick glazing bars, as glass might just be produced in small sheets.
  • Victorian (1837-- 1901): As glass manufacturing enhanced, bigger panes ended up being readily available. The "two-over-two" design ended up being popular, typically featuring ornamental "horns" to enhance the frame.
  • Edwardian (1901-- 1910): Often featured a multi-pane upper sash over a big, single-pane lower Sash Window Restoration Company, optimizing natural light while keeping conventional visual appeals.

Why Choose Timber? The Core Benefits

Lumber is a natural insulator, making it an exceptional product for window frames. When contemporary joinery techniques are used to standard styles, the outcome is a window that uses 21st-century convenience without sacrificing historical integrity.

1. Superior Aesthetics and Heritage Value

For homes found in sanctuary or listed structures, timber sash windows are often a legal requirement. Even in non-protected areas, timber offers a depth of character and a "soft" visual that artificial materials can not duplicate.

2. Environmental Sustainability

Wood is the only genuinely sustainable structure product. When sourced from FSC (Forest Stewardship Council) or PEFC (Programme for the Endorsement of Forest Certification) accredited forests, timber windows have a significantly lower carbon footprint than uPVC options. In addition, wood serves as a carbon sink, keeping CO2 throughout its lifespan.

3. Durability and Repairability

While uPVC windows typically last 20 to 30 years before the plastic breaks down or the seals fail, a properly maintained lumber sash window can last over 60 to 80 years. Critically, lumber is repairable. If a section of a wood frame rots, it can be entwined and fixed; if a uPVC frame cracks or fades, the whole unit usually requires replacing.

4. Thermal and Acoustic Performance

Modern lumber sash windows use innovative weather-stripping and high-performance glazing. Wood's natural cellular structure offers excellent thermal resistance, reducing heat loss and assisting to dampen external noise-- an essential function for city citizens.


Understanding Timber Types

The efficiency of a sash window is heavily based on the kind of wood utilized. Makers normally categorize wood into softwoods, woods, and engineered/modified woods.

Table 1: Comparison of Window Timbers

Timber TypeTypical SpeciesResilienceMaintenance IntervalBest For
SoftwoodEuropean Redwood, PineModerate3-- 5 YearsBudget-conscious jobs; needs routine painting.
WoodOak, Sapele, UtileHigh5-- 8 YearsHigh-end finishes; outstanding natural rot resistance.
Customized TimberAccoyaExtraordinary10-- 12 YearsOptimum stability; withstands warping/swelling; long guarantees.

Key Components of a Timber Sash Window

A sash window is a complex piece of engineering. Comprehending its anatomy is essential for any property owner or designer.

  • The Box Frame: The outer frame that houses the sashes and the internal weights.
  • The Sashes: The movable parts of the window (top and bottom) that hold the glass.
  • Weights and Pulleys: Lead or steel weights connected by a cord (or chain) over a pulley to counterbalance the weight of the sash.
  • Spiral Balances: A contemporary alternative to weights and sheaves, utilizing a spring tension system. They enable slimmer "non-box" frames.
  • Satisfying Rail: The horizontal part where the top and bottom sashes satisfy in the middle.
  • Glazing Bars (Muntins): The thin strips of wood that different private panes of glass.
  • Sash Horns: Decorative extensions on the top sash that prevent the joints from being strained by the weight of bigger glass panes.

Modern Glazing Options

While conventional sash windows featured single glazing, modern replacements use a number of choices to enhance energy efficiency:

  1. Slimline Double Glazing: Designed specifically for heritage homes, these systems are thin enough (normally 12mm to 14mm total thickness) to fit into conventional sash profiles without looking large.
  2. Vacuum Glazing: An emerging innovation where the air in between two panes is gotten rid of to develop a vacuum. This provides the insulation of triple glazing with the density of single glazing.
  3. Acoustic Glass: Specialized laminated glass developed to substantially decrease decibel levels from street traffic.

Maintenance and Care Tips

To maximize the life expectancy of lumber sash windows, a proactive maintenance schedule is necessary.

  • Yearly Cleaning: Wash the frames with warm soapy water to eliminate atmospheric pollutants and salt (specifically in coastal locations).
  • Inspect the Paint Film: Inspect for cracks or flaking in the paint every spring. Little cracks should be sanded and touched up instantly to prevent moisture ingress.
  • Oil Pulleys: Ensure the pulley wheels turn freely by using a percentage of light machine oil or silicone spray once a year.
  • Wax the Channels: If the sashes are sticking, using a little beeswax or candle light wax to the running channels can make sure smooth operation.
  • Internal Draught Proofing: Modern brush seals need to be examined to ensure they have not become flattened or clogged with dust.

Frequently Asked Questions (FAQ)

1. Are timber sash windows draughty?

2. Do lumber sash windows need a lot of upkeep?

While they need more care than plastic, modern-day factory-applied coverings have changed the game. Using customized woods like Accoya and high-quality microporous paints, you may just need to repaint every 10 to 12 years.

3. Can I set up double glazing in my existing timber frames?

Generally, yes. This process, known as "retrofitting," includes routing out the existing sash to accommodate a slimline double-glazed unit. This protects the original box frame while improving thermal effectiveness.

4. Why are timber windows more pricey than uPVC?

The cost shows the quality of the raw products, the knowledgeable craftsmanship required for joinery, and the superior durability of the item. Timber is an investment that increases the resale worth of a property.

5. Are they protect?

Modern wood sashes include sophisticated locking systems, including sash fasteners and "dual screws" or "restrictors" that allow the window to be secured a somewhat open position for ventilation without compromising security.
